Perhaps there's hope for Khazan...? (New article about Neople's reallocation, dated April 10th)

https://gamingbolt.com/the-first-berserker-khazan-nexon-says-restructuring-is-not-related-to-workforce-reduction

Some highlights from the news:

The First Berserker: Khazan is the first of three games designed to introduce our Dungeon & Fighter to a global audience. The game got off to a solid launch with good critical scores in Western markets on both PC and console,” said the company in a statement.

The fact that The First Berserker: Khazan missed sales targets set by Nexon hasn’t really been a secret. The company revealed during an earnings call last month that its Q1 revenue for the game was lower than expected. Despite this, however, it “achieved our objective as a strategic first step in a multi-year plan to introduce Dungeon & Fighter IP to a global audience.”

This adjustment is not related to workforce reduction or team dissolution. It reflects a planned reallocation of talent to support live service operations and new initiatives across Neople and Nexon affiliates.”
